Formula Business Restrictions - Pacific Grove, CA

City Code forbids any permits for food establishments that have the following characteristics: specializes in short order or quick service food service, food is served primarily in paper, plastic or other disposable containers, customers may easily remove food or beverage products from the food service establishment for consumption, and it is a formula food service establishment required by contractual or other arrangements to operate with standardized menus, ingredients, food preparation, architecture, decor, uniforms, or similar standardized features.
Pacific Grove City Code
§23.64.115 Food service establishments
(a) Applications for use permits for food service establishments shall be accepted and processed under the terms of Chapter 23.72 of this code.
(b) No use permit application shall be accepted, processed or considered for a food service establishment having all of the following characteristics:
(i) It specializes in short order or quick service food service;
(ii) It serves food primarily in paper, plastic or other disposable containers;
(iii) It delivers food or beverage products in such a manner that customers may remove such food or beverage products from the food service establishment for consumption;
(iv) It is a formula food service establishment required by contractual or other arrangements to operate with standardized menus, ingredients, food preparation, architecture, decor, uniforms, or similar standardized features.
(Ord. 1999 N.S. § 3, 1995).
